3. As a citizen of Mexico, what rights do you have?-right of having a home-right to be respected-right to have health-right to an education-right to a good alimentation and clothing-right to be judged by a fair trialWhat responsibilities do you have?-Make their children or pupils study in a public or private school-Every Mexican must have attended pre-school, primary and secondary as well as social service (if the law states it)-Enroll to serve the country for various purposes: defend the independence, honor the nation, territory, right and obligations of the nation and peace of the country.-Contribute for the public incomes of the country, respecting and paying the taxes assigned by the government.
